What is Educational Neuroscience and the implications in the classroom

Juan Víctor Concepción Cardona's picture

Educational neuroscience is an interdisciplinary field that explores the intersection between neuroscience and education. It aims to use findings from neuroscience to inform educational practices and improve learning outcomes. The field seeks to understand how the brain develops, processes information, and learns, and how this knowledge can be applied to enhance teaching and educational strategies.

Implications in the Classroom:

  1. Individualized Instruction: Educational neuroscience can help educators tailor their teaching methods to individual students' learning styles, cognitive abilities, and developmental stages. This may involve recognizing and accommodating diverse learning profiles within a classroom.

Bridge to PhD in Neurosciences Program (Summer Research Program)

Irving Vega's picture

ENDURE (Enhancing Neuroscience Diversity through Undergraduate Research Education Experiences) is a series of interrelated programs designed to develop students for PhD programs in Neurosciences, Biomedical, and Behavioral Sciences. The program is designed to develop students' interest and success as graduate scholars in PhD programs.

Nominate your students for USGS summer internships

Ariadna S. Rubio Lebrón's picture

The US Geological Survey is seeking to create a pathway whereby students with excellent training in biological field methods can be nominated and apply for summer internships at USGS. Selected applicants will be offered internships at available field, laboratory, or office related scientific positions throughout the country for up to 5 months. USGS places interns wherever the project scientists need them.
